Can I live in Guadalajara on $2,000/month?
Living in Guadalajara on $2,000/mo is rated "Comfortable". Budget allocates ~$1,014 to rent, $441 to groceries, $245 to dining.
Can I live in Florence on $2,000/month?
In Florence, $2,000/mo is rated "Tight Budget". Allocations: $1,095 rent, $307 groceries, $202 dining.
Is Guadalajara or Florence cheaper?
Guadalajara is generally cheaper. COL+Rent: Guadalajara 24.5 vs Florence 45.3 (NYC=100).
What is $2,000/mo in Guadalajara worth in Florence?
$2,000/mo of purchasing power in Guadalajara equals ~$3,698/mo in Florence using COL adjustment.
